10th annual tribute to John Lennon & The Beatles

Posted

RIVER FALLS – Beatles’ fans of all ages are invited to enjoy the 10th annual Tribute to John Lennon and the Beatles at 1:30 p.m. Sunday, Dec. 12 at the River Falls Public Library’s lower level community room.

River Falls poet and musician Thomas R. Smith organizes this annual music performance and poetry reading to honor former Beatle John Lennon, whose death on Dec. 8, 1980 was a sad day for all those who loved his music.

The band consists of Smith and Doug Wilson on guitars and vocals, Ken Thatcher on percussion, Chris TerMaat on piano, and vocals by a three-piece back-up chorus featuring Lucinda Plaisance, Krista Spieler and Kathy Ward. This is not a strict duplication of the Beatles sound but a folky, acoustic-based performance, and singing along is not only welcomed but encouraged.

Special guests will include River Falls poet Thomas Hendrickson and Twin Cities poet Klecko.

Admission is free. COVID safety precautions are in place, and masks are required.
